Dental implant is known as a method to replace a lost tooth... Since the implant has high strength by being fixed in the jaw, and on the other hand, its appearance and function is similar to a natural tooth, it is considered one of the best methods to replace a lost tooth. Since the dental implant is placed in the jaw and relies on the surrounding bone for support, there must be enough tissue in the jaw bone to support the implant well.. This makes the dentist check the jaw before performing the implant and take the necessary measures if there is not enough bone density to solve this problem... ### **General Health**
Since the dental implant requires anesthesia or gum surgery, the person must be in good general health. If you suffer from a certain disease, consult your doctor before getting the implant done so as not to cause any problems for the person. People who are in the following conditions should be more careful and under the supervision of a doctor:
- Uncontrolled diabetes
- Radiation therapy
- pregnancy
- Use of blood thinners and steroid drugs
- Weakness in general health

For whom dental implants are not suitable?..
- People who don't have enough bone density and don't want a bone graft.... - People who have unhealthy habits like teeth grinding.... - People who don't care about their oral health.... - People who have certain medical conditions like those who have recently had a heart attack.... - People who use drugs like bisphosphonates (such as anti-osteomasis or Zumta) or other anti-osteoporosis drugs.. People under 18 year because their jawbone is still growing...

When is the right age for dental implants?
For many people, the question may arise at what age a dental implant can be done... To do the implant, the patient's jaw bone must have reached full development, or in other words, the person's skeletal maturity must be complete.... Normally, people reach this maturity at the age of 18; But the growth of the jaw may continue until the age of 25, and this matter should be checked by a dentist and the necessary measures should be taken.. - Patient's general health

Implants are divided into different types based on different factors as follows:
### **Dental implants based on fixture type**
Dental implants are divided into the following three categories based on the type of fixture:
- Endosteal implant (inside the bone)
- Sub-perio steel implant (on the bone)
- Zygomatic implant
### **Types of dental implants based on implantation stages**
According to the number of stages of dental implant implantation, it is divided into the following types:
- Single stage dental implant
- Two-stage dental implants
### **Types of dental implants based on size**
Dental implants include the following types based on size:
- Standard implant
- Mini dental implant
- Wide implant
### **Types of dental implants based on appearance**
Based on appearance, implants can be divided into the following types:
- Conical implant
- Cylindrical implant
- Smooth implant
### **Types of implants based on materials**
Implants are usually produced in the following types:
- Titanium
- Zirconium
### **Types of dental implants based on the type of connection**
In terms of connection type, the following types can be considered for implants:
- Internal hexagonal connection (male connection)
- External hexagonal connection (male connection)
